The noun has one meaning:
Meaning #1:
blindness in one half of the visual field of one or both eyes
Synonym: hemianopia

Hemianopsia is the loss of half of a field of vision. When the pathology involves both eyes, the following specific terms are used:
Hemi - half
an - without
opsia - seeing
